Titles for Audi Sport customer racing, two drivers' and two teams' titles on a single afternoon

in ADAC GT Masters and Blancpain GT Series Sprint Cup

Land-Motorsport wins ADAC GT Masters with Christopher Mies/Connor De PhillippiEnzo Ide celebrates Blancpain success with Belgian Audi Club Team WRT

Two drivers� and two teams� titles on a single afternoon � the customers of Audi Sport customer racing popped the champagne bottles on the first weekend in October. The teams won two of the world�s most fiercely fought GT3 series, the ADAC GT Masters and the Blancpain GT Series Sprint Cup.

Audi drivers have celebrated the title win in the ADAC GT Masters for an amazing third time. Following Christian Abt (2009) and Ren� Rast/Kelvin van der Linde (2014), Christopher Mies/Connor De Phillippi were unbeatable this year. The German-American driver duo won in a dramatic finale at the Hockenheimring. After the fiercest rivals chasing the Audi campaigners had retired due to an accident, both drivers prevailed against another competitor in the points classification. In Saturday�s race, the American De Phillippi had already secured the Junior classification. A strong debut performance was achieved by their race team as well. Wolfgang Land�s Team Montaplast by Land-Motorsport relied on the Audi R8 LMS for the first time this year and was instantly successful.

Nearly at the same time, 1,200 kilometers further south, at Barcelona, another important European title decision was made in the Blancpain GT Series Sprint Cup. The Belgian Enzo Ide, together with the Dutchman Robin Frijns, won the qualifying race and occupied third place in the main race, marking the first international title success for the 25-year-old Ide. Before the finale, he was tied on points in position one with his teammate Christopher Mies, but Mies had opted not to race in Spain in order to contest the ADAC GT Masters. Belgian Audi Club Team WRT additionally celebrated success in the teams� classification of the Sprint Cup. Vincent Vosse�s squad is one of the most successful outfits of all Audi Sport customer racing teams. The company founded in 2010 has won an amazing eight overall drivers� titles in racing, plus the squad�s tally includes eleven additional titles and six endurance racing victories in 24-hour races in Belgium, Germany and Dubai.

�Sincere congratulations to our victorious teams and drivers,� said Chris Reinke, Head of Audi Sport customer racing. �They delivered thrilling racing this year against very tough competitors, showed great fighting spirit and good team performances, and won in the respective finales. Now we�re wishing our other teams a lot of success for the remaining title decisions this year.�
